Wow I swear I didn't copy this ! In Brendan Haywood's latest blog post , he said it is a sad day. A sad day because Songaila is leaving. Thomas and Opech were not mentioned... "On a sad note, we’re sad to see Darius Songalia leave our team. He’s a true professional and did way more than he was asked to for our team, especially last year with all of our injuries. He’s a good friend of mine and I’ll miss him as well as the Washington staff and fans - we wish him luck!"
